Before starring as Timothy McVeigh in Showtime's 2023 series Waco: The Aftermath, Alex Breaux shares the screen with series lead Kiowa Gordon from AMC's hit show Dark Winds in this award winning indie thriller.

In the future, every U.S. citizen has the right to own one clone of themself. Clones have no rights and can only become citizens if emancipated by their original human.

After 30 years together, Alex suddenly elects to emancipate his clone Richie, but his closest friends begin to question his true intentions.

Director Biography - Ryan M. Kennedy

Ryan M. Kennedy is an American screenwriter and film director. His feature film debut An Act of War was released on March 31, 2015 in North America by Revolver Entertainment and was available to stream on Netflix, Hulu, Amazon, and countless other platforms. He attended Montclair State University where he graduated with a Bachelors of Fine Arts in Filmmaking, and is currently working on a Masters Degree from Georgetown University.

Director Statement

After the release of my first film An Act of War, I was struck with a yearning desire to learn as much as I could about the various aspects of filmmaking beyond my experiences while directing. I subsequently enrolled into the film program at Montclair State University where I graduated with a Bachelor of Fine Arts in Filmmaking. CLONE was my senior thesis film, and every ounce of my heart and soul went into bringing this script to life. Along with my producing partners, our amazingly talented cast and crew made this project possible, and I'm delighted to finally be able to share it with an audience.
